• Home
  • Raw
  • Download

Lines Matching refs:netdev

98 			if (have_ifidx && wdev->netdev &&  in __cfg80211_wdev_from_attrs()
99 wdev->netdev->ifindex == ifidx) { in __cfg80211_wdev_from_attrs()
122 struct net_device *netdev; in __cfg80211_rdev_from_attrs() local
162 netdev = __dev_get_by_index(netns, ifindex); in __cfg80211_rdev_from_attrs()
163 if (netdev) { in __cfg80211_rdev_from_attrs()
164 if (netdev->ieee80211_ptr) in __cfg80211_rdev_from_attrs()
166 netdev->ieee80211_ptr->wiphy); in __cfg80211_rdev_from_attrs()
2616 struct net_device *netdev; in nl80211_dump_wiphy_parse() local
2620 netdev = __dev_get_by_index(sock_net(skb->sk), ifidx); in nl80211_dump_wiphy_parse()
2621 if (!netdev) { in nl80211_dump_wiphy_parse()
2625 if (netdev->ieee80211_ptr) { in nl80211_dump_wiphy_parse()
2627 netdev->ieee80211_ptr->wiphy); in nl80211_dump_wiphy_parse()
2961 struct net_device *netdev = info->user_ptr[1]; in nl80211_set_channel() local
2963 return __nl80211_set_channel(rdev, netdev, info); in nl80211_set_channel()
2992 struct net_device *netdev = NULL; in nl80211_set_wiphy() local
3017 netdev = __dev_get_by_index(genl_info_net(info), ifindex); in nl80211_set_wiphy()
3018 if (netdev && netdev->ieee80211_ptr) in nl80211_set_wiphy()
3019 rdev = wiphy_to_rdev(netdev->ieee80211_ptr->wiphy); in nl80211_set_wiphy()
3021 netdev = NULL; in nl80211_set_wiphy()
3024 if (!netdev) { in nl80211_set_wiphy()
3030 netdev = NULL; in nl80211_set_wiphy()
3033 wdev = netdev->ieee80211_ptr; in nl80211_set_wiphy()
3054 if (!netdev) in nl80211_set_wiphy()
3057 if (netdev->ieee80211_ptr->iftype != NL80211_IFTYPE_AP && in nl80211_set_wiphy()
3058 netdev->ieee80211_ptr->iftype != NL80211_IFTYPE_P2P_GO) in nl80211_set_wiphy()
3061 if (!netif_running(netdev)) in nl80211_set_wiphy()
3078 result = rdev_set_txq_params(rdev, netdev, in nl80211_set_wiphy()
3088 nl80211_can_set_dev_channel(wdev) ? netdev : NULL, in nl80211_set_wiphy()
3317 struct net_device *dev = wdev->netdev; in nl80211_send_iface()
3606 struct net_device *netdev, u8 use_4addr, in nl80211_valid_4addr() argument
3610 if (netdev && netif_is_bridge_port(netdev)) in nl80211_valid_4addr()
3817 if (!wdev->netdev) in nl80211_del_interface()
5499 if (!wdev->netdev) { in nl80211_dump_station()
5511 err = rdev_dump_station(rdev, wdev->netdev, sta_idx, in nl80211_dump_station()
5521 rdev, wdev->netdev, mac_addr, in nl80211_dump_station()
6411 err = rdev_dump_mpath(rdev, wdev->netdev, path_idx, dst, in nl80211_dump_mpath()
6420 wdev->netdev, dst, next_hop, in nl80211_dump_mpath()
6610 err = rdev_dump_mpp(rdev, wdev->netdev, path_idx, dst, in nl80211_dump_mpp()
6619 wdev->netdev, dst, mpp, in nl80211_dump_mpp()
7964 if (wdev->netdev) in nl80211_trigger_scan()
7965 dev_hold(wdev->netdev); in nl80211_trigger_scan()
8853 if (wdev->netdev && in nl80211_send_bss()
8854 nla_put_u32(msg, NL80211_ATTR_IFINDEX, wdev->netdev->ifindex)) in nl80211_send_bss()
9113 if (!wdev->netdev) { in nl80211_dump_survey()
9124 res = rdev_dump_survey(rdev, wdev->netdev, survey_idx, &survey); in nl80211_dump_survey()
9140 wdev->netdev, radio_stats, &survey) < 0) in nl80211_dump_survey()
9892 if (wdev->netdev && in __cfg80211_alloc_vendor_skb()
9894 wdev->netdev->ifindex)) in __cfg80211_alloc_vendor_skb()
12903 (wdev->netdev && nla_put_u32(msg, NL80211_ATTR_IFINDEX, in cfg80211_nan_match()
12904 wdev->netdev->ifindex)) || in cfg80211_nan_match()
12985 (wdev->netdev && nla_put_u32(msg, NL80211_ATTR_IFINDEX, in cfg80211_nan_func_terminated()
12986 wdev->netdev->ifindex)) || in cfg80211_nan_func_terminated()
13190 !wdev->netdev) in nl80211_vendor_cmd()
13368 !wdev->netdev) { in nl80211_vendor_cmd_dump()
14194 dev = wdev->netdev; in nl80211_pre_doit()
14232 if (wdev->netdev) in nl80211_post_doit()
14233 dev_put(wdev->netdev); in nl80211_post_doit()
15235 (wdev->netdev && nla_put_u32(msg, NL80211_ATTR_IFINDEX, in nl80211_prep_scan_msg()
15236 wdev->netdev->ifindex)) || in nl80211_prep_scan_msg()
15425 struct net_device *netdev, in nl80211_send_mlme_event() argument
15445 nla_put_u32(msg, NL80211_ATTR_IFINDEX, netdev->ifindex) || in nl80211_send_mlme_event()
15475 struct net_device *netdev, const u8 *buf, in nl80211_send_rx_auth() argument
15478 nl80211_send_mlme_event(rdev, netdev, buf, len, in nl80211_send_rx_auth()
15483 struct net_device *netdev, const u8 *buf, in nl80211_send_rx_assoc() argument
15487 nl80211_send_mlme_event(rdev, netdev, buf, len, in nl80211_send_rx_assoc()
15493 struct net_device *netdev, const u8 *buf, in nl80211_send_deauth() argument
15496 nl80211_send_mlme_event(rdev, netdev, buf, len, in nl80211_send_deauth()
15501 struct net_device *netdev, const u8 *buf, in nl80211_send_disassoc() argument
15504 nl80211_send_mlme_event(rdev, netdev, buf, len, in nl80211_send_disassoc()
15532 struct net_device *netdev, int cmd, in nl80211_send_mlme_timeout() argument
15549 nla_put_u32(msg, NL80211_ATTR_IFINDEX, netdev->ifindex) || in nl80211_send_mlme_timeout()
15565 struct net_device *netdev, const u8 *addr, in nl80211_send_auth_timeout() argument
15568 nl80211_send_mlme_timeout(rdev, netdev, NL80211_CMD_AUTHENTICATE, in nl80211_send_auth_timeout()
15573 struct net_device *netdev, const u8 *addr, in nl80211_send_assoc_timeout() argument
15576 nl80211_send_mlme_timeout(rdev, netdev, NL80211_CMD_ASSOCIATE, in nl80211_send_assoc_timeout()
15581 struct net_device *netdev, in nl80211_send_connect_result() argument
15601 nla_put_u32(msg, NL80211_ATTR_IFINDEX, netdev->ifindex) || in nl80211_send_connect_result()
15640 struct net_device *netdev, in nl80211_send_roamed() argument
15660 nla_put_u32(msg, NL80211_ATTR_IFINDEX, netdev->ifindex) || in nl80211_send_roamed()
15691 struct net_device *netdev, const u8 *bssid) in nl80211_send_port_authorized() argument
15707 nla_put_u32(msg, NL80211_ATTR_IFINDEX, netdev->ifindex) || in nl80211_send_port_authorized()
15722 struct net_device *netdev, u16 reason, in nl80211_send_disconnected() argument
15739 nla_put_u32(msg, NL80211_ATTR_IFINDEX, netdev->ifindex) || in nl80211_send_disconnected()
15758 struct net_device *netdev, const u8 *bssid, in nl80211_send_ibss_bssid() argument
15775 nla_put_u32(msg, NL80211_ATTR_IFINDEX, netdev->ifindex) || in nl80211_send_ibss_bssid()
15834 struct net_device *netdev, const u8 *addr, in nl80211_michael_mic_failure() argument
15852 nla_put_u32(msg, NL80211_ATTR_IFINDEX, netdev->ifindex) || in nl80211_michael_mic_failure()
15946 (wdev->netdev && nla_put_u32(msg, NL80211_ATTR_IFINDEX, in nl80211_send_remain_on_chan_event()
15947 wdev->netdev->ifindex)) || in nl80211_send_remain_on_chan_event()
16183 struct net_device *netdev = wdev->netdev; in nl80211_send_mgmt() local
16198 (netdev && nla_put_u32(msg, NL80211_ATTR_IFINDEX, in nl80211_send_mgmt()
16199 netdev->ifindex)) || in nl80211_send_mgmt()
16224 struct net_device *netdev = wdev->netdev; in cfg80211_mgmt_tx_status() local
16241 (netdev && nla_put_u32(msg, NL80211_ATTR_IFINDEX, in cfg80211_mgmt_tx_status()
16242 netdev->ifindex)) || in cfg80211_mgmt_tx_status()
16491 struct net_device *netdev, const u8 *bssid, in nl80211_gtk_rekey_notify() argument
16509 nla_put_u32(msg, NL80211_ATTR_IFINDEX, netdev->ifindex) || in nl80211_gtk_rekey_notify()
16547 struct net_device *netdev, int index, in nl80211_pmksa_candidate_notify() argument
16565 nla_put_u32(msg, NL80211_ATTR_IFINDEX, netdev->ifindex)) in nl80211_pmksa_candidate_notify()
16603 struct net_device *netdev, in nl80211_ch_switch_notify() argument
16622 if (nla_put_u32(msg, NL80211_ATTR_IFINDEX, netdev->ifindex)) in nl80211_ch_switch_notify()
16687 struct net_device *netdev, gfp_t gfp) in nl80211_radar_notify() argument
16706 if (netdev) { in nl80211_radar_notify()
16707 struct wireless_dev *wdev = netdev->ieee80211_ptr; in nl80211_radar_notify()
16709 if (nla_put_u32(msg, NL80211_ATTR_IFINDEX, netdev->ifindex) || in nl80211_radar_notify()
16960 if (wdev->netdev && nla_put_u32(msg, NL80211_ATTR_IFINDEX, in cfg80211_report_wowlan_wakeup()
16961 wdev->netdev->ifindex)) in cfg80211_report_wowlan_wakeup()
17154 void cfg80211_ft_event(struct net_device *netdev, in cfg80211_ft_event() argument
17157 struct wiphy *wiphy = netdev->ieee80211_ptr->wiphy; in cfg80211_ft_event()
17162 trace_cfg80211_ft_event(wiphy, netdev, ft_event); in cfg80211_ft_event()
17177 nla_put_u32(msg, NL80211_ATTR_IFINDEX, netdev->ifindex) || in cfg80211_ft_event()
17252 nla_put_u32(msg, NL80211_ATTR_IFINDEX, wdev->netdev->ifindex) || in nl80211_send_ap_stopped()
17307 void cfg80211_update_owe_info_event(struct net_device *netdev, in cfg80211_update_owe_info_event() argument
17311 struct wiphy *wiphy = netdev->ieee80211_ptr->wiphy; in cfg80211_update_owe_info_event()
17316 trace_cfg80211_update_owe_info_event(wiphy, netdev, owe_info); in cfg80211_update_owe_info_event()
17327 nla_put_u32(msg, NL80211_ATTR_IFINDEX, netdev->ifindex) || in cfg80211_update_owe_info_event()